“The referee further found that by misappropriating clients’ funds being held in his trust account Attorney Lieuallen violated the standard of conduct set forth by this court in Disciplinary Proceedings Against Marine, 82 Wis. 2d 602, 609-10, 264 N.W.2d 285 (1978) and, therefore, violated SCR 20:8.4(f).”

We agree with the referee that attorney Lieuallen’s gross pattern of misconduct, including the conversion of more than $60,000 of clients’ funds to his own use, warrants the revocation of Lieuallen’s license to practice law in Wisconsin. He must also make restitution to the parties listed in the referee’s report and pay the Office of Lawyer Regulation the costs of this proceeding.

So ordered.
